When looking for the ideal treadmill, several key features ought to be taken into consideration:

Motor Power (HP): Typically, a motor with at least 2.0 HP is advised for walking and light jogging, while major runners might need 3.0 HP or more.

Belt Size: A longer and larger belt is necessary for comfort and safety. Standard sizes range from 45 inches in length for walkers to 60 inches for runners.

Incline Options: The capability to adjust the incline simulates hill running, enhancing exercise intensity. Look for treadmills with at least 10% incline capability.

Innovation Integration: Many modern-day treadmills come equipped with Bluetooth connectivity, built-in speakers, and compatibility with physical fitness apps.

Weight Capacity: Most treadmills support weights as much as 250 pounds. However, heavier choices are offered for more robust users.

Service warranty Period: A great guarantee can provide comfort. Search for a minimum of a 10-year guarantee on the frame and a minimum of 1-2 years on parts.

How much area do I require for a treadmill?
It's recommended to have at least 6 feet of length and 3 feet of width around the treadmill for safe use.
2. Can I utilize a treadmill without a power outlet?
Manual [treadmills on sale](https://postheaven.net/sonteam2/10-things-that-your-family-teach-you-about-running-machine-for-home) do not require electrical energy, while electric treadmills need to be plugged into a basic outlet.
3. How frequently should I lubricate my treadmill?
Lubrication is generally required every 3 months, however this can vary based upon use. Always inspect the maker's recommendations.
4. Are home treadmills appropriate for running?
Yes, many home treadmills are developed with running in mind, however ensure the motor power and belt size are sufficient for your needs.
5. Can treadmills be folded for storage?
Yes, lots of designs provide a folding choice for easy storage, especially advantageous for those with limited area.
